How To Fix HRASR00_JPESS025 - You are not authorized to process this request


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: HRASR00_JPESS - JP ESS Project

  • Message number: 025

  • Message text: You are not authorized to process this request

    The SAP error message HRASR00_JPESS025 ("You are not authorized to process this request") typically indicates that the user does not have the necessary authorizations to perform a specific action within the SAP system, particularly in the context of HR (Human Resources) processes.

    Cause:

    1.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the required roles or authorizations assigned to their user profile to access the specific transaction or function.
    2. Role Configuration: The roles assigned to the user may not include the necessary authorizations for the HR processes they are trying to access.
    3. Missing Authorization Objects: The authorization objects related to the HR processes may not be properly configured or assigned to the user’s role.
    4. Organizational Level Restrictions: There may be restrictions based on organizational levels (e.g., company code, personnel area) that prevent the user from accessing certain data.

    Solution:

    1. Check User Roles: Verify the roles assigned to the user in the SAP system. This can be done by using transaction code SU01 (User Maintenance) to check the user’s profile.
    2. Review Authorizations: Use transaction code SU53 immediately after encountering the error to see which authorization check failed. This will provide insight into what specific authorization is missing.
    3. Adjust Roles: If the user lacks the necessary authorizations, work with your SAP security team to adjust the roles or create a new role that includes the required authorizations.
    4. Authorization Objects: Ensure that the relevant authorization objects (e.g., P_ORGIN, P_PERNR) are included in the user’s roles. You may need to consult with your SAP security administrator to make these changes.
    5. Testing: After making changes, have the user log out and log back in to see if the issue is resolved. It may also be helpful to test the access in a development or quality assurance environment before applying changes in production.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es:
      • SU01: User Maintenance
      • SU53: Display Authorization Check
      • PFCG: Role Maintenance
    • Authorization Objects: Familiarize yourself with the relevant authorization objects for HR processes, such as:
      • P_ORGIN: HR Master Data
      • P_PERNR: Personnel Number
    •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or your organization’s internal guidelines for managing user roles and authorizations.

    If the issue persists after checking the above points, it may be necessary to consult with your SAP Basis or security team for further investigation.
